uname
用的时候发现一个小秘密:
uname -n 跟hostname命令的效果是一样的,都是显示主机名。
uname 和uname -s 都是查看内核名字
用法:uname [选项]...
输出一组系统信息。如果不跟随选项,则视为只附加-s 选项。
-a, --all 以如下次序输出所有信息。其中若-p 和
-i 的探测结果不可知则被省略:
-s, --kernel-name 输出内核名称
-n, --nodename 输出网络节点上的主机名
-r, --kernel-release 输出内核发行号
-v, --kernel-version 输出内核版本
-m, --machine 输出主机的硬件架构名称
-p, --processor 输出处理器类型或"unknown"
-i, --hardware-platform 输出硬件平台或"unknown"
-o, --operating-system 输出操作系统名称
--help 显示此帮助信息并退出
--version 显示版本信息并退出
实例:
[root@station6 ~]# uname
Linux
[root@station6 ~]# uname -a
Linux station6.sxkeji.com 2.6.32-279.el6.i686 #1 SMP Wed Jun 13 18:23:32 EDT 2012 i686 i686 i386 GNU/Linux
[root@station6 ~]# uname -s
Linux
[root@station6 ~]# uname -n
station6.sxkeji.com
[root@station6 ~]# uname -r
2.6.32-279.el6.i686
[root@station6 ~]# uname -v
#1 SMP Wed Jun 13 18:23:32 EDT 2012
[root@station6 ~]# uname -m
i686
[root@station6 ~]# uname -p
i686
[root@station6 ~]# uname -i
i386
[root@station6 ~]# uname -o
GNU/Linux